__ is a software development activity that is not a part of software processes.

  • A. a) Validation
  • B. b) Specification
  • C. c) Development
  • D. d) Dependence
Correct Answer: D. d) Dependence
Dependence is correctly identified as the option that is not a software development activity.

Understanding the Terms

Validation: This is a crucial step in software development to ensure that the product meets the specified requirements. It involves testing the software against the original objectives.

Specification: This is the process of defining the software requirements in detail. It outlines what the software should do.

Development: This is the actual coding and implementation phase of the software. It involves creating the software product.

Why Dependence is Different

Dependence refers to the relationship between software components or modules. It's a characteristic or attribute of the software, not an action or process involved in creating it.

Dependence is essential to understand the software's structure and how changes in one part might affect others, but it's not an active step in the development lifecycle.

In essence, while dependence is a critical aspect of software architecture and maintenance, it's not a process or activity undertaken to build the software itself.

If you think there is any confusion in the given MCQs, you can comment below.

Follow us on WhatsApp

docmcqs.com is Pakistan's No.1 online platform for preparing for all types of exams including PPSC, FPSC, KPSC, SPSC, Ministry of Defence, and for one-paper MCQs. This includes Pedagogy MCQs, general knowledge MCQs, current affairs MCQs, and much more.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top